Transaction 7ee40c72cf892286831766f1753f796e7bf177cc71a6620bde01d167c8029ab5
1 Input
1 Output
-
7ee40c72cf892286831766f1753f796e7bf177cc71a6620bde01d167c8029ab5:0
- value
- 670992
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2577706abd2b1ac26bfad5836648c30478463e50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14R75sgiaXBU31z4ZK5xSq6kEfyhKM6eP3